On the morning of October 16, Prof. Ajay Vinzé, Associate Vice Provost for Graduate Education of Arizona State University (ASU) and Associate Dean for International Programs of W. P. Carey School of Business of ASU, visited Sun Yat-sen University (SYSU). Prof. Zhu Xiping, Vice President of SYSU, met with the guests, accompanied by Ms. Xu Yao, Deputy Director of Office of International Cooperation & Exchange of SYSU.

 
Vice President Zhu Xiping meeting with Prof. Ajay Vinzé, Associate Vice Provost for Graduate Education of Arizona State University 
 
Prof. Zhu Xiping welcomed Prof. Ajay Vinzé on his first visit to SYSU, and introduced the general situation of SYSU. Prof. Ajay Vinzé said that Chinese universities are important partners of ASU, and he was glad to establish a connection with SYSU. The two sides discussed the possibility of cooperation in student exchange, short-term study visit, joint program and administrative staff training, and planned to conduct cooperation in such fields as business, engineering and health sciences.

During the visit, Prof. Ajay Vinzé also met with Prof. Lu Jun, Deputy Dean of Lingnan College. They exchanged views on cooperation in business student exchange and joint program.

Founded in 1885, Arizona State University is an internationally renowned research university, ranked 146th in Times Higher Education World University Rankings 2013-2014.
